
Jacqueline O’ Duffy, the wife of Kerry businessman Nathan McDonnell who was jailed last year for importing millions of euro worth of drugs has appeared on a court summons list accused of drug driving offences.
Jackie, 44, is accused of having drugs in her system on August 23, 2025, while driving/attempting to drive in Clogherbrien in Tralee.
Nathan McDonnell who ran the Ballyseedy Garden Centre in Tralee is currently serving a 12 year sentence after he was found guilty of helping an organised crime gang with links to the Sinaloa Cartel in Mexico, bring more than €32m of drugs into the country.

It was the largest consignment of crystal meth to be imported into the country.
Nathan McDonnell was once regarded as one of Kerry’s most prominent businessmen after taking over the garden-centre business started by his family, three generations ago in Tralee.

Jacqueline who was not required to appear in court was represented by her solicitor, Padraig O’ Connell, who has applied for full disclosure of all evidence in the case.
The case has been adjourned until June 24. Within this time, Jacqueline will decide whether she will plead ‘guilty’ or not guilty to the charge.
